NABARD has been designated as the Project Manager for the digitalization of cooperatives under the guidance of the National Level Monitoring and Implementation Committee and the Ministry of Cooperation.

Nearly 10,000 cooperative societies have already been digitalized, he said at a conference organized by Sa-Dhan, an association of microfinance institutions. We are targeting to digitalize 65,000 committees by March 2024.
On the shortcomings in the level of efficiency in cooperative societies over the years, he said, we are trying to make them important value chain players by improving transparency and computerization of these institutions. He said that NABARD is also creating a data warehouse for cooperative societies and the rural sector. It should be ready in about six months.
